MAA Spring Show and "Old Keys"

Last night was the "Meet the Artists" reception and
awards for the Midland Arts Association Spring Show.
It was a beautiful, well attended event.
There were 75 pieces selected from 279 entries.
I was excited that my "Old Keys" watercolor
was juried in. The show runs until April 10th.
